Cerebral microbleeds after use of extracorporeal membrane oxygenation in children

Insights

Cerebral microbleeds (CMB) are common in children on extracorporeal membrane oxygenation (ECMO) as seen on gradient-recalled echo (GRE) MRI. These findings suggest potential vascular damage from gaseous emboli during ECMO treatment.

Background:

  • Cerebral microbleeds (CMB) are rare in children but seen in adults after vascular procedures.
  • Extracorporeal membrane oxygenation (ECMO) is linked to neurological issues in children.
  • No prior reports exist on GRE MRI findings in pediatric ECMO patients.

Observation:

  • Retrospective review of pediatric vascular neurology consultations over 5 years.
  • Gradient-recalled echo (GRE) MRI was acquired in 6 of 12 pediatric ECMO cases.
  • All 6 cases with GRE MRI (mean age 2.1 years) showed CMB.

Findings:

  • 100% of pediatric ECMO patients with GRE MRI demonstrated CMB.
  • CMB were multiple, cortical/lobar, with right carotid distribution predominance.
  • No other intracranial hemorrhages were observed.

Implications:

  • CMB are a notable finding on GRE MRI in children treated with ECMO.
  • Findings may indicate vascular damage resulting from gaseous emboli.
  • Highlights the utility of GRE MRI in assessing neurological complications in pediatric ECMO.
